## Image Caption

Known as the Ewell Pendant, this piece was made in the late 7th century CE in the [Mediterranean](https://www.worldhistory.org/disambiguation/mediterranean/). It features a bearded man wearing a phrygian cap. Made of [gold](https://www.worldhistory.org/gold/) and garnet. Measures 32 x 21.5 x 9 mm. Found in Ewell, [England](https://www.worldhistory.org/disambiguation/england/) (British Museum, London)
